Call for Applications: Dahlem Junior Host Program 2022

Funding program for academic staff: from the humanities, history and cultural studies at the Free University of Berlin

With the Dahlem Junior Host Program (DJHP), the Dahlem Humanities Center (DHC) supports the international networking of young scientists at Freie Universität Berlin. The DHC promotes

Academic staff: inside the humanities departments (FUB) as hosts: inside (junior hosts) of guest academics: inside and outside Germany

Funding amount: up to € 8,000 per application
Application deadline: October 1, 2021
Earliest start of the guest stay: February 2022

The program enables scientists in the doctoral and postdoc phase to invite a scientist to Freie Universität Berlin whose work is central to their research. The program of the guest stay is flexibly based on the academic objectives of the applicant. Possible concrete measures are, for example, the conception and work on joint publications, the editing of a joint research proposal, co-teaching projects, the implementation of digital humanities projects, the conception and implementation of your own science communication formats or the organization of one or more guest lectures and / or work meetings. Scientists of all career levels can be invited for a period of up to 12 weeks. It is desirable that the cooperation be carried out in Berlin. If this is not possible due to the pandemic, the cooperation can also take place online. In this case, an alternative concept to digital collaboration must be submitted.

For the implementation of scientific workshops, short stays for several guest researchers can also be applied for with the same maximum funding amount.

Eligibility to apply

Scientific employees (doctoral candidates and postdocs up to 6 years after the date of the disputation) who are members of the Department of Philosophy and Humanities or the Department of History and Cultural Studies at Freie Universität Berlin at the time of application and the planned guest stay are eligible to apply . Child-rearing periods within the period are taken into account at a flat rate of two years per child under 12 years of age.

Employees in the departments of the humanities, history and cultural studies institutes are particularly invited to apply; In the case of applications from employees / scholarship holders from research associations, clusters and other third-party funded institutions, it must be explained why the planned activity cannot be financed from project funds.

Funding conditions

As part of the DJHP, funds to finance the travel and stay of a guest or several guests and the implementation of joint projects totaling € 8,000 can be applied for. The funds to be awarded are lump sums for guest stays and projects, not funds to finance jobs. The requested guest stay can commence on February 1, 2022 at the earliest and must commence on October 17, 2022 at the latest.
